| from __future__ import annotations | |
| from typing import Optional, Tuple | |
| import numpy as np | |
| def fix_num_vertices( | |
| vertices: np.ndarray, | |
| *, | |
| num_vertices: int, | |
| vertex_sampling: str, | |
| pad_value: float, | |
| sample_idx: Optional[np.ndarray] = None, | |
| ) -> Tuple[np.ndarray, np.ndarray, Optional[np.ndarray]]: | |
| """Pad or sample a vertex array to a fixed token count. | |
| Returns: | |
| vertices_fixed: Array with shape ``(num_vertices, 3)``. | |
| mask: Float mask with shape ``(num_vertices,)``; real vertices are 1 and padding is 0. | |
| sample_idx: Reusable sampled indices when the input was downsampled. | |
| """ | |
| target_vertices = int(num_vertices) | |
| current_vertices = int(vertices.shape[0]) | |
| if current_vertices == target_vertices: | |
| return vertices, np.ones((target_vertices,), dtype=np.float32), sample_idx | |
| if current_vertices > target_vertices: | |
| if sample_idx is not None and int(sample_idx.max()) >= current_vertices: | |
| sample_idx = None | |
| if sample_idx is None: | |
| if vertex_sampling == "random": | |
| sample_idx = np.random.choice(current_vertices, target_vertices, replace=False) | |
| elif vertex_sampling == "first": | |
| sample_idx = np.arange(target_vertices) | |
| else: | |
| raise ValueError(f"Unknown vertex_sampling: {vertex_sampling}") | |
| return vertices[sample_idx], np.ones((target_vertices,), dtype=np.float32), sample_idx | |
| pad = np.full((target_vertices - current_vertices, 3), pad_value, dtype=vertices.dtype) | |
| vertices_fixed = np.concatenate([vertices, pad], axis=0) | |
| mask = np.zeros((target_vertices,), dtype=np.float32) | |
| mask[:current_vertices] = 1.0 | |
| return vertices_fixed, mask, sample_idx | |
